In the basketball national high school championship, the women's final was held on the 28th, and Aichi's Sakuraka Gakuen won a close battle with Kyoto Seika Gakuen to win the tournament for the third consecutive time.

The women's final of the basketball national high school championship "Winter Cup" was held at the Tokyo Metropolitan Gymnasium in Shibuya Ward, Tokyo, where Okagakuen and Kyoto Seika Gakuen, aiming for the third straight victory, played against each other.



In the first half of the game, Okagakuen took the lead with consecutive points of second grader Tomomi Yokoyama, but Kyoto Seika Gakuen also caught up with the tie of 30 to 30 with captain Segawa Shinwaru's three-point shot. Wrap back.



In the second half, it was a one-off battle, but at Sakuraka Gakuen, captain Azusa Asahina scored points with a shot under the goal in the fourth quarter of the game, and after that, Yokoyama's score expanded the lead and sticked. We shook off Kyoto Seika Gakuen 61 to 57 and won a close battle.



Okagakuen has won the tournament for the third time in a row and won the championship for the 24th time in total.



Asahina, the captain of Okagakuen High School, said, "I'm really happy. I've been working hard for three years and I'm grateful for the support of those around me."
